Munsell Color 2.5Y 5/4 light olive brown
Description The soil is yellowish-olive brown. The SE co-ordinate depth measurements are made on the NW corner of the section of soil left around the base of the tree in the SE corner. The number of fist-size and smaller stones is significantly larger than in locus 13. The bottom of the locus is almost packed with stones. There is a fairly large stone in the NW sector of this locus (circa 55 x 35 x 20 cm.). Approximately one bowl (16 cm. in diameter/8 cm. in depth) of small well-worn terracotta fragments was recovered. 100 pottery sherds were found.
